#850f4c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#850f4c is composed of 52.2% red, 5.9% green and 29.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 88.7% magenta, 42.9% yellow and 47.8% black. It has a hue angle of 329 degrees, a saturation of 79.7% and a lightness of 29%. #850f4c color hex could be obtained by blending #ff1e98 with #0b0000. Closest websafe color is: #990033.

#850f4c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#850f4c has RGB values of R:133, G:15, B:76 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.89, Y:0.43, K:0.48. Its decimal value is 8720204.

Shades and Tints of #850f4c
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0a0105 is the darkest color, while #fef7fb is the lightest one.

Tones of #850f4c
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#4c484a is the less saturated color, while #90044c is the most saturated one.
